To pronounce "implicit", say IMPL-ic-it — 3 syllables, IPA /ɪmˈplɪsɪt/. Tap play below to hear it in four English accents, or practice it syllable by syllable.

"implicit" has 3 syllables: impl-ic-it. It rhymes with elicit and solicit, if that helps it stick.

Implicit: Implied indirectly, without being directly expressed
